Chef Nowel
Chef Nowel is a celebrated Vegan Culinary Artist, author, and Certified Holistic Nutritionist from Compton, California. After being diagnosed with Lupus in 2010, she transitioned to a plant-based lifestyle, and within a few years, she achieved a Lupus-free clean bill of health.
She is the author of Throw Some Greens on That Sh*t and So, You’re Interested in Giving Up Meat, where she shares her expertise in plant-based cuisine and holistic nutrition. Her mission is two-fold: to educate and empower others on self-care through smart food shopping and preparation, while also proving that plant-based eating can be flavorful, exciting, and accessible.
A proud Compton native, Chef Nowel earned her Bachelor of Science from Central State University in Wilberforce, Ohio, and her Master’s in Applied Psychology with a concentration in Public Health from The Chicago School of Professional Psychology. Her talent and dedication have earned her two Vegan Foodie Choice Awards, and she was a contestant on Top Vegan, Season 1.
With a passion for making vegan cuisine approachable and delicious, Chef Nowel continues to inspire communities through education, innovation, and bold flavors.
